Home Water Filtration in Columbus, OH
Home water filtration services involve the installation, maintenance, and upgrade of systems designed to improve the quality of tap water throughout a property. These services typically cover projects such as installing whole-house filtration units, under-sink filters, or point-of-use systems to reduce common contaminants like chlorine, sediment, and minerals. Property owners often seek information about the types of filtration options available, how they can address specific water quality concerns, and what maintenance might be required to keep systems functioning effectively over time.
Before requesting water filtration services, homeowners should understand their current water quality and any specific issues they want to resolve. It’s helpful to review water test results or consider common local water concerns, such as taste, odor, or mineral content. Property owners also usually want to know about the different system options that suit their household size and water usage, as well as the installation process and ongoing upkeep involved in maintaining clean, safe water for everyday use.

Common Home Water Filtration Jobs
Water Filter Installation - improves tap water quality through custom filtration systems.
Reverse Osmosis Systems - provides thorough removal of contaminants for clean drinking water.
Whole House Filtration - ensures filtered water flows to every faucet and appliance.
Sediment and Particle Filters - eliminate dirt, rust, and debris from incoming water supply.
UV Water Purification - uses ultraviolet light to reduce bacteria and viruses.
Maintenance and Filter Replacement - helps maintain optimal filtration performance and water quality.
Home Water Filtration Questions
What is home water filtration? Home water filtration involves installing systems to improve water quality by removing impurities and contaminants for safer, clearer water.
What types of water filtration systems are available? Common options include point-of-use filters, whole-house systems, and reverse osmosis units tailored to specific water needs.
How often should a water filtration system be maintained? Regular maintenance typically involves changing filters or cartridges every 6 to 12 months, depending on usage and system type.
What are signs that a water filtration system might be needed? Signs include unusual taste or odor, visible particles, or decreased water flow from fixtures.
